The Intracranial Stents Market is anticipated to grow at a CAGR of 9.3% with USD 13.7 Bn in 2026 and is expected to reach USD 22.8 Bn in 2033. Rising cases of ischemic strokes and aneurysms drive demand in the intracranial stents market. Globally, stroke incidence has increased by 70%, with ischemic strokes representing nearly 87% of all cases. Rising metabolic disorders and sedentary lifestyles are driving higher stroke rates among adults under 40. In India, a stroke occurs approximately every 30 seconds, with a growing burden among younger populations.

Brain Aneurysm expected to hold the largest market share of 53.3% in 2026 owing to its advancements in neurointerventional devices. Rising cases of brain aneurysms drive demand for intracranial stents as physicians increasingly adopt minimally invasive endovascular treatments. Advanced imaging techniques help clinicians detect both ruptured and unruptured aneurysms more effectively, resulting in more diagnosed cases that require intervention. Clinicians choose stent-assisted coiling for complex and wide-neck aneurysms because it improves coil stability and supports vessel reconstruction. Growing awareness, better healthcare access, and expanding neurovascular treatment facilities further encourage the use of intracranial stents in aneurysm management worldwide. For instance, Kaneka Corporation has started selling its i-ED COIL brain aneurysm embolisation coil in Europe as of October 2025. The company secured EC certification under the EU Medical Device Regulation in July, enabling market entry. Kaneka is distributing the product mainly across Europe through its subsidiary, Kaneka Medical Europe N.V.
Self-Expanding Intracranial Stents hold the largest market share of 52.8% in 2026. Rising cases of intracranial aneurysms, stroke, and intracranial arterial stenosis drive demand for self-expanding intracranial stents, as clinicians increasingly use minimally invasive neurointerventional treatments. Physicians prefer endovascular procedures over open neurosurgery because they reduce recovery time and complications. Ongoing advancements in nitinol-based stents, enhanced flexibility, and improved delivery systems improve procedural success in complex cerebral vessels. The growing number of specialized stroke centers and skilled neurointerventional also increases the use of these stents in hospitals globally. Hospitals acquired the largest market share of 52.9% in 2026. Hospitals increase demand for intracranial stents as they function as primary centers for neurointerventional procedures such as aneurysm repair and stroke management. Rising patient admissions for acute neurovascular conditions drive greater use of stent-based therapies. Hospitals invest in advanced imaging systems, hybrid operating rooms, and endovascular equipment to support complex procedures. Skilled neurosurgeons and interventional radiologists improve treatment outcomes. Expanding stroke centers and strong reimbursement support further reinforce hospital adoption of intracranial stents worldwide.

North America is expected to acquire the dominant share of 39.20% in 2026. North America drives the intracranial stents market with a high burden of neurovascular disorders such as stroke, intracranial aneurysms, and arterial stenosis. Advanced healthcare infrastructure supports the widespread adoption of minimally invasive endovascular procedures. Hospitals and stroke centers invest in cutting-edge imaging systems and hybrid operating rooms to perform complex stent-based interventions. Skilled neurointerventional specialists improve treatment outcomes across the region. Favorable reimbursement systems and rapid adoption of innovative stent technologies further strengthen regional market growth. For instance, in June 2024, MicroVention, Inc., a global neurovascular company and subsidiary of Terumo Corporation, launched the LVIS EVO Intraluminal Support Device in the United States. The company now offers the device commercially for treating wide-neck intracranial aneurysms.
Asia Pacific intracranial stents market trends reflect strong growth as rising cases of stroke, intracranial aneurysms, and intracranial stenosis affect aging populations and lifestyle-related risk factors. Healthcare systems across emerging economies expand access to advanced neurointerventional procedures and increase adoption of minimally invasive treatments. Hospitals invest in modern imaging systems and endovascular technologies to improve procedural outcomes. Growing awareness of early diagnosis, along with improving healthcare infrastructure and expanding stroke care centers, further accelerates the use of intracranial stents across the region. For instance, India Medtronic Private Limited has launched its CE-marked fourth-generation flow diverter, Pipeline Vantage with Shield Technology, for the endovascular treatment of brain aneurysms. The company has introduced the device with upgraded design features in both the delivery system and the implant to improve procedural performance and treatment outcomes.

China’s intracranial stents market is developing steadily as neurovascular disorders rise and more healthcare providers adopt minimally invasive procedures. Hospitals are expanding their neurointerventional capabilities by upgrading infrastructure and increasing physician awareness. Domestic companies are introducing innovative, cost-effective stent solutions, while international players are strengthening their market position through strategic partnerships. Advances in imaging technologies and catheter-based delivery systems are improving treatment precision and outcomes, and urban medical centers across China are increasingly integrating these modern neurointerventional approaches into routine clinical practice.
Some of the major key players in Intracranial Stents are Medtronic Plc, Balt Extrusion S.A., MicroPort Scientific Corporation, Abbott Laboratories, Stryker Corporation, Admedes Schuessler GmbH, Cardiatis, S.A, DePuy Synthes, Acandis GmbH, and Penumbra, Inc.
